CHICAGO — A Chicago Lawn man was killed and another person was injured Monday morning in a shooting in Back of the Yards, authorities said.

About 9 a.m., a 23-year-old man and a 17-year-old boy were standing in the 5000 block of South Winchester Avenue when two men got out of a vehicle and opened fire on them, said Officer Thomas Sweeney, a police spokesman.

The two gunmen fled the scene. The 23-year-old was transferred to Holy Cross Hospital but was pronounced dead on arrival, authorities said. He was identified as Joseph Lewis, of the 3500 block of West 60th Place, according to the Cook County Medical Examiner's Office.

The 17-year-old boy was taken to Stroger Hospital where he was listed in critical condition, Sweeney said.
